QuickBooks error PS077appears on your screen when your payroll update fails because of a damaged or corrupted company file. Running Verify and Rebuild Data tool will help you to fix this error:
Verify your Company’s Data
Go to the File menu.
From the dropdown, select Utilities.
Now, click Verify Data to find common errors in your company file.
Rebuild Data to fix common errors in your company file
Click on the File menu.
Select Utilities from the dropdown menu.
You will be asked to create a company file backup; tap OK.
Here, create a new backup file rather than replace the old one.
Rebuilding your data will be done when you get the message Rebuild has Completed; tap OK.
